iGaming Idol doubled in size and sets a new standard for Industry award events
![iGaming Idol doubled in size and sets a new standard for Industry award events](https://europeangaming.eu/portal/wp-content/uploads/2017/10/Igaming-Idol-2017.jpg)
NetEnt take home most awards whilst Mr Green and Jackpot Joy follow. Robin Ramm Ericson & Gustaf Hagman of Leo Vegas win Outstanding Contribution to the Industry.
The much-awaited second annual iGaming Idol gala awards dinner lit up the Industry with a full capacity attendance of 430 iGaming executives, employees, friends and 18 new âIdols of the Yearâ.
The event, which doubled in its attendance figures when compared to the 2016 edition, was held in the prestigious Grand Master Suite at the Hilton Hotel in St Julianâs, Malta.
Distinguished guests were welcomed to the black-tie event with red-carpet treatment and champagne on arrival, before being hosted to a three-course dinner and a night of glitz and glamour by industry personalities Michael Caselli, Editor in Chief of iGaming Business, and Rebecca Liggero from Calvin Ayre.
Michael Pedersen, CEO of iGaming idol, welcomed the guests, finalists and sponsors by thanking them for their support, whilst he reiterated that those attending were supporting the Industry and the local community in a major way.
Mr Pedersen said: âiGaming Idol is all about the recognition of individuals and giving employees within the industry their due importance. Supporting charity and giving back to the community is another pillar of iGaming Idol and we are thrilled to donate more than âŹ12,000 to the Malta Community Chest Fund this year.â
Special guest, the Hon Silvio Schembri, Paliamentary Secretary for Financial Services, Digital Economy and Innovation, delivered the opening speech by praising the organisers for their innovative concept in recognising the talent behind the industryâs success.
He congratulated all the finalists, noting that it was encouraging to see a good number of Maltese nationals had made the list in several categories. Hon Schembri also announced that Government was taking measures to facilitate work permits and visas to attract more foreign talent.
The attendees were entertained throughout the evening with live music, and the hosts were on spectacular form.

The evening culminated in the awards ceremony and 16 winners taking home the title of âIdol of the Yearâ within their respective categories. The finalists were put through a rigorous process including being interviewed by expert judges from the same category.
In addition to the 16 Idols, prestigious awards were given out to Robin Ramm Ericson and Gustaf Hagman of Leo Vegas for winning âOutstanding Contribution to the Industryâ as well as Catena Media for taking home âEmployer of the Yearâ. The iGaming Idol Awards are fully audited by BDO Malta, an affiliate organisation of BDO International.
The winners were:
Category | Winner | Company |
Affiliate Manager Idol of the Year | Laura O Brien | Mr Green |
Business Intelligence Idol of the Year | Andrew Galea | NetRefer |
Casino Product Idol of the Year | Alan Brincat | Quasar Gaming |
Compliance and Regulated Markets Idol of the Year | Ewout Wierda | Videoslots |
Customer Service Idol of the Year | Viktor Mardberg | Jackpot Joy |
Design & User Experience Idol of the Year | Martin McDonald | Join Games |
Fraud & Risk Idol of the Year | Daniel Buttitieg | APCO Pay |
HR Idol of the Year | Roberta Geres | Mr Green |
Live Casino Dealer Idol of the Year | Joscelyn James Sims | NetEnt |
Manager Idol of the Year | Lahcene Merzoug | Evoke |
SEO/SEM Idol of the Year | Sean Bianco | Quasar Gaming |
Sports Product Idol of the Year | Tamara Caligari | Tipico |
Recruitment Idol of the Year | Jakob Wallof | NetEnt |
Tech Back-end Idol of the Year | Anthony Sammut | NetEnt |
Tech Front-end Idol of the Year | Kurt Aquilina | Play N Go |
VIP Manager Idol of the Year | Steve DeGiorgio | Jackpot Joy |
Outstanding Contribution to the Industry | Robin Ramm Ericson & Gustaf Hagman | Leo Vegas |
Employer of the Year | Catena Media |

MARE BALTICUM Gaming & TECH Summit 2024 Sparked GameTech Revolution and Unity Across the Baltics and Nordics
![MARE BALTICUM Gaming & TECH Summit 2024 Sparked GameTech Revolution and Unity Across the Baltics and Nordics](https://europeangaming.eu/portal/wp-content/uploads/2024/06/PR-featured-image.jpg)
HIPTHER, leading conference organizer for Gaming and Technology industries in Europe, is thrilled to announce the completion of a revolutionary 2024 edition for their successful MARE BALTICUM Gaming & TECH Summit series.
The #hipthers brought together in Tallinn some of the best companies and most distinguished experts across iGaming, Technology and Compliance industries between 3-5 June, offering a premium experience of growth and connectivity to local and international professionals.

From the Baltic and Nordic Standards to the World: iGaming & Compliance Updates
Day 1 of the Summit was brimming with Compliance updates and insights from panels focusing both on the local standards, as well as keeping up with global compliance trends. Renowned experts debated the the complexities and nuances of the iGaming regulatory landscape in the Baltics and Nordics, offered a concise overview of the complex regulatory frameworks in Serbia, the USA, Spain, Germany, and Estonia, and provided Insights into Market Dynamics, Trends, and Sports Betting Evolution in the Nordic iGaming Landscape.
Furthermore, delegates had the precious opportunity to attend an IMGL Masterclass about Navigating MiCA, EU AI Act, and DSA in the Digital Age.
Exploring Fintech, Blockchain, and the Potential of DAOs in the Gaming Industry
The Summit offered valuable insights on the evolution of financial institutions, exploring the integration of fintech and blockchain and the challenges and opportunities it brings.
Our experts introduced the concept of Decentralized Autonomous Organizations (DAOs) and how they are emerging as a transformative force in the gaming industry, offering new possibilities for community-driven game development, player-owned economies, and transparent governance.
Exploring Digital Engagement: Esports Dynamics, Gamification, Mobile Innovation, AI and Web3
True to its title of Gaming & TECH, the conference delved deep into all matters Tech, ranging from Gaming and the global challenges and opportunities within the eSports industry, the strategic integration of gamification to boost player retention and loyalty in the iGaming sector, and the Digital Services Act and AI EU Act for businesses, to the Integration of Blockchain and Web3 Across Industries.
A specially designed Workshop on Baltic Compliance in Web3, Fintech, and Blockchain offered a deep dive into Estonia, Latvia, and Lithuania’s regulatory frameworks, featuring interactive discussions and case studies.
The Power of Communication: Marketing & Organizational Culture Sessions
The MARE BALTICUM Summit speakers offered insights and ample food for thought for all aspects of Marketing in GameTech, starting from the power collab between SEO and Affiliate Marketing Websites, and highlighting the crossroads between B2B and B2C on the path to commercial success.
Honouring the commitment to offering valuable knowledge across the spectrum of GameTech operations, HIPTHER innovates by adding the matter of Organizational Culture in the industryâs Conference Agenda under the guidance of expert Organizational Culture Designers.
